Understanding Sash Windows
Sash windows consist of several movable panels (or “sashes”) that slide vertically or horizontally. Unlike standard casement windows which open outwards, sash windows are created for ease of use and visual appeal, making them a popular option in numerous types of structures, specifically in city settings.
Typical Issues with Sash Windows
Over time, sash windows may come across numerous problems, consisting of:

When engaging a sash window refurbishment company, the process usually involves numerous essential stages:
1. Initial Assessment
A competent specialist will perform a comprehensive examination to examine the condition of the windows. This consists of checking for rot, draughts, and general wear and tear.
2. Removal and Repair
The company will safely eliminate the sashes for repair. This may involve:
Replacing harmed wood: Rotting wood will be changed or treated to avoid more decay.Re-glazing: If the glass panes are cracked or lost, they will be changed to restore the window’s integrity.StepDescription1Assess condition2Eliminate sashes for repair3Change harmed wood and re-glaze3. Reinstallation
After repairs and refinishing, the sashes will be reinstalled. This stage might also include:
Weatherproofing: Enhanced seals are fitted to guarantee energy performance.Sash cords and weights replacement: Old systems are changed to make sure smooth operation.4. Final Finishing Touches
The last action often involves painting or staining the sashes to match the existing aesthetics and safeguard the wood even more.

FAQsWhat is the typical cost of sash window refurbishment?
The cost varies based upon the level of repairs needed, the products utilized, and the size of the window. Usually, house owners can anticipate to pay in between ₤ 250 to ₤ 750 per window.
The length of time does the refurbishment process take?
Depending upon the scope of work, the refurbishment can take anywhere from a couple of days to a number of weeks. A professional company will provide a timeline during the initial evaluation.
Can I refurbish sash windows myself?
While DIY refurbishment is possible, it is highly recommended to engage experts to make sure quality work. Poor repairs might lead to more damage and higher costs in the long run.
How can I maintain my refurbished sash windows?
Regular maintenance consists of checking for indications of decay, painting or staining as required, and guaranteeing that seals stay intact to prevent draughts.
